More Than 1,300 Builders Converge On Capitol Hill

Washington, DC, May 10, 2006--More than 1,300 builders from across the country are holding nearly 400 meetings today with their representatives and senators to urge them to increase housing opportunities for all Americans.

Fed Expected to Raise Rates Today

Washington, DC, May 10, 2006--Federal Reserve policy-makers began a meeting on Wednesday that economists expect will yield a 16th straight interest-rate hike but also may signal that future increases are less certain.

Unilin Grants New Click Flooring Licenses

Wielsbeke, Belgium, May 2006--On May 8, 2006, BuildDirect, one of Canada’s largest online wholesalers of building materials, based in Vancouver, entered into a license agreement with Flooring Industries, a unit of Unilin.

Small-Business Optimism Up in April

Washington, DC, May 9, 2006--Small-business optimism rose last month, reversing March’s slump by more than two points to 100.1 (1986=100) and returning to its historical levels, according to the NFIB Small Business Economic Trends report.

Unifi Announces Proposed Offering

Greensboro, NC, May 9, 2006--Unifi said it plans to commence a private placement offering of $225 million of Senior Secured Notes due 2014.

Chain Store Sales Off Last Week

New York, NY, May 9, 2006--Chain store sales slipped in the latest week after a strong gain the previous week, according to a report released on Tuesday.
